Time to Get Ready:
- Preparation time: 15 minutes
- Cooking time: 30 minutes
- Total time: 45 minutes
Ingredients:
- 1 medium cauliflower, cut into small florets
- 1 teaspoon of salt
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 2 eggs
- 30 ml cream (approximately 2 tablespoons)
- Black pepper, to taste
- Grated Parmesan cheese (around 50 g, or to taste)
- 100 g soft mozzarella, torn into small pieces
- Paprika, to taste
Instructions:
-
Prepare the cauliflower:
- Preheat your oven to 200°C (392°F).
- Bring a pot of water to a boil. Add a pinch of salt and cook the cauliflower florets for 5 minutes.
- Drain and pat the cauliflower dry with a kitchen towel to remove excess moisture.
-
Roast the cauliflower:
- Spread the cauliflower florets on a baking sheet. Drizzle with olive oil and toss to coat evenly.
- Roast in the preheated oven for about 10 minutes, until the cauliflower begins to turn golden.
-
Prepare the egg mixture:
- In a bowl, whisk together the eggs, cream, black pepper, and a generous amount of grated Parmesan cheese.
-
Assemble the dish:
- Transfer the roasted cauliflower to a greased baking dish.
- Pour the egg mixture over the cauliflower, ensuring it’s evenly covered.
- Add more grated Parmesan cheese and tear the mozzarella into small pieces, sprinkling it over the top.
- Sprinkle paprika on top for extra flavor and color.
-
Bake the cauliflower cheese:
- Bake in the oven for another 20 minutes, or until the cheese is melted and the top is golden brown.
-
Serve:
- Allow the dish to cool slightly before serving. This can be enjoyed as a main dish or a side.
Serving Suggestions:
- Serve with a simple green salad for a healthy meal.
- Pair with grilled chicken, steak, or fish for a complete meal.
- Serve with crusty bread to soak up any extra sauce.
- Use as a topping for baked potatoes or pasta.
- Garnish with fresh parsley or chives for added color and freshness.
